Transaction 1603d580eea3cfa74f9299565cc80139cf2c77bf0bc56c6046408011786161f9

1 Input
2 Outputs
  • 1603d580eea3cfa74f9299565cc80139cf2c77bf0bc56c6046408011786161f9:0
  • value  3904611
    address  394MM919iSjF6YdgfH4BDfrNURort92Vea
  • 1603d580eea3cfa74f9299565cc80139cf2c77bf0bc56c6046408011786161f9:1
  • value  95940898
    address  16raNS9axc7ALxEtFvrnzk4CcmDVtqnMYQ